Has anyone attempted this? i have searched and i saw a couple threads that show you how to rebuild a mitsu turbo and its pretty straight forward. so is this something i can do or do i HAVE to send it to FP?
 
Same as any other TD05H/TD06 rebuild.

The FP Green and Red are balanced as a rotating assembly, so you'll want to mark the alignment of the compressor wheel on the shaft.

It would be a good idea to use a rebuild kit with the wider thrust collar and two oiling holes in the thrust plate as the 50-trim compressor wheel is much heavier than your average TD05H wheel, putting added stress on the turbo's thrust system.

You CAN rebuilt it but you DEF DEF DEF DEF NEED TO have it balanced by a pro. TRUST ME
Completely false.

If there's no wheel damage, rebalancing a turbo at the time of a rebuild is a waste of money. TRUST ME.

upon closer inspection, i noticed that the exhaust housing has some cracks in it, can i use the same kind of mitsu exhaust housing or do i need something else?

It will have to fit a TD06H turbine, and those housings are very rare. As long as it's not cracked through the housing where it would leak, it's not going to be a problem.
